    Here are a couple pics of my project cars and daily drivers.

    The first three are of my 1974 Volvo 164. The engine is new and has about 45 minutes of run time on it. The carbs are off a Penta AQ170 boat engine and the intake and linkage needed some heavy modification to make it work. Got the motor running yesterday, it sounds fierce. The fourth pic is of my 1976 BMW 2002, nice daily driver. Last pic is of my fathers 1968 Volvo 145 Wagon. Has a 2L heavily modified engine (cam, balanced, headwork, headers) and will blow the doors off a civic, accord, whatever...

    Just thought I would share a piece of my world.
